Want it! Alma folding cot by bloom
I got an email at work yesterday about this product and instantly fell in love – as I tend to do with all of bloom’s baby products! The Alma cot is basically a wooden travel cot that folds up for easy storage; perhaps not suitable for taking on holiday with you but certainly for us it would have been an ideal solution when Bubs was sleeping in our room as a small baby, and for now when he needs a cot at his childminder’s house – somehow the fact that it’s wooden makes it seem more secure than the canvas ones. It looks so easy to assemble compared to the travel cot we currently use (not to mention being much better looking!) and is also sized for urban living spaces, so an ideal solution if your nursery is less than roomy. It also has lockable, removable castors, a two-position base and is suitable for use up to 24 months. I love!
